Today, Hinge Health (NYSE: HNGE) released its sixth annual State of Musculoskeletal (MSK) Care Report, revealing how today’s fragmented healthcare system leaves many people unsure how to pursue treatment for MSK pain. Hinge Health surveyed 1,000 people living with MSK pain alongside 295 healthcare providers to understand the systemic challenges and opportunities for industry-wide improvements. The dual-perspective survey – along with real patient and provider stories – maps a clear path to more effective, unified care.

Hinge Health, Inc. (NYSE: HNGE) today announced a new study showing that participants in its chronic back pain program had substantially fewer imaging visits, such as X-rays and MRIs, compared to a similar group of individuals who sought traditional PT care. The peer-reviewed study, published in The Journal of Health Economics and Outcomes Research found that of the 4,330 participants, those who used Hinge Health had 60% fewer imaging visits for low back pain at three months compared to the control group.
